OpenAI CEO Warns of Terrifying AI 'Doom' Risk

TL;DR Summary
Emmett Shear, the new CEO of OpenAI, has expressed concerns about the dangers of artificial intelligence (AI), stating that it is "intrinsically dangerous" and poses a threat of causing "doom" to humanity. Shear believes that as AI becomes smarter and self-improving, it could quickly surpass human control, leading to potentially catastrophic consequences. His views align with those of his predecessor, Sam Altman, who has warned about the risk of AI on par with nuclear weapons and pandemics. Altman, Shear, and other experts have called for global prioritization of mitigating AI risks.
